ALTAR TILE - PENTACLE - AFRICAN MAHOGANY

Altar Tiles are used as representations of ones religious/spiritual orientation.  They can be placed on altars as symbols and outward meanings for the individual’s sacred space - they also associated with the element of earth.  Altar Tiles can be used in ceremonial magick as an instrument of protection, a tool to invoke spirits or as a tool on which to place objects to be ceremonially consecrated.  These tiles can also be hung over doors and windows to act as protective devices.

The Soul Space Studio range of Altar Tiles are made from wood, the symbols are ‘grooved’ into the wooden surface and the entire tile is coated with a hard-wearing varnish.  The back of the tiles are blank to provide space for the user to add their own sigils and symbols.
